Está en la página 1de 2

El "Modelo Relacional" o "Relational Model" es un concepto fundamental en

el campo de las bases de datos. Fue propuesto por Edgar F. Codd en 1970, y
se ha convertido en el estándar predominante para la gestión de datos en
sistemas informáticos. Aquí te proporciono una investigación estructurada
sobre en qué consiste este modelo:

1. Definición y Principios Fundamentales:


• Definición: El Modelo Relacional es un modelo de datos para
representar y manipular datos en forma de tablas o relaciones.
• Principios Fundamentales:
• La información se organiza en tablas bidimensionales.
• Cada tabla tiene un nombre único y está compuesta por filas (tuplas) y
columnas (atributos).
• Cada fila representa una entidad específica y cada columna representa
un atributo de esa entidad.
• Se establecen relaciones entre las tablas a través de claves primarias y
claves foráneas.
2. Estructura de Datos:
• Tablas: Son la estructura principal del Modelo Relacional. Cada tabla
tiene un nombre único y está compuesta por un conjunto de filas y
columnas. Las filas representan registros individuales y las columnas
representan atributos de esos registros.
• Claves Primarias: Son campos (o conjunto de campos) que identifican
de forma única cada fila en una tabla. Garantizan la integridad de los
datos y evitan la duplicación de registros.
• Claves Foráneas: Son campos en una tabla que establecen una relación
con la clave primaria de otra tabla. Permiten vincular datos entre tablas
y establecer la integridad referencial.
3. Operaciones:
• Selección: Permite recuperar filas específicas de una tabla que cumplen
ciertas condiciones.
• Proyección: Permite seleccionar ciertas columnas de una tabla y crear
una nueva tabla con esas columnas.
• Unión: Combina filas de dos o más tablas basándose en una condición
de igualdad entre columnas.
• Intersección: Devuelve las filas que están presentes en ambas tablas.
• Diferencia: Devuelve las filas que están presentes en una tabla, pero no
en otra.

4. Ventajas y Desafíos:
Ventajas:
• Estructura organizada y fácil de entender.
• Integridad de los datos garantizada mediante claves primarias y
foráneas.
• Flexibilidad para realizar consultas complejas y análisis de datos.
Desafíos:
• Diseño adecuado de la estructura de las tablas y relaciones.
• Rendimiento en consultas con grandes volúmenes de datos.
• Complejidad en la gestión de actualizaciones y modificaciones de la
base de datos.
5. Aplicaciones:
• El Modelo Relacional se utiliza ampliamente en sistemas de gestión de
bases de datos relacionales (RDBMS) como MySQL, PostgreSQL,
Oracle, SQL Server, entre otros.
• Es utilizado en una amplia gama de aplicaciones, incluyendo sistemas
empresariales, sitios web, sistemas de información, aplicaciones
móviles, entre otros.
En resumen, el Modelo Relacional es un enfoque poderoso y ampliamente
utilizado para la gestión de datos, que proporciona una estructura organizada y
flexible para representar y manipular la información en sistemas informáticos.

También podría gustarte